THE Mandaue City Police Office is taking steps to ensure the safety and security of churches and malls in Mandaue during the upcoming Holy Week celebrations.In an interview with the media on Wednesday, March 20, 2024, Police Colonel Julius Sagandoy, new director of the MCPO, said that they will be focusing specifically on protecting these areas of convergence where people tend to gather to celebrate the occasion.
